MEC Announces Men's Soccer Preseason Poll
BRIDGEPORT, W.Va. – The Mountain East Conference released their 2025 Men's Soccer Preseason Poll on Tuesday afternoon with Frostburg State sliding into the eighth spot.
Frostburg is coming off a remarkable season in 2024, posting a 10-8-1 overall record and a 7-6-1 showing in conference competition for a fourth place finish in the MEC, having their best start since to a season since 2015. The Bobcats hosted their first-ever playoff game last year since joining Division II in 2019, defeating West Liberty to move on to the semifinals.
The defending MEC champions of Charleston sit at the top of the poll with 49 total points and seven of the first-place votes, while Davis & Elkins takes the second spot with 43 points and one first-place vote. FSU shows 12 points in the poll, coming in behind Wheeling who serves 15.
The Bobcats kick off their season at home with a MEC contest against Concord on Sunday, September 7 at 2 PM.
2025 MEC Men's Soccer Preseason Poll | ||
Rank | Team (1st Place Votes) | Points |
1. | Charleston (7) | 49 |
2. | Davis & Elkins (1) | 43 |
3. | Concord | 35 |
4. | West Liberty | 27 |
5. | West Virginia Wesleyan | 24 |
6. | Point Park | 19 |
7. | Wheeling | 15 |
8. | Frostburg State | 12 |
* Coaches not permitted to vote for own team
